Walter Public Investments Inc. increased its position in Mastercard Incorporated (NYSE:MA - Free Report) by 5.4% in the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 49,825 shares of the credit services provider's stock after buying an additional 2,571 shares during the period. Mastercard comprises 4.7% of Walter Public Investments Inc.'s portfolio, making the stock its 4th largest holding. Walter Public Investments Inc.'s holdings in Mastercard were worth $27,999,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Mastercard (NYSE:MA -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, July 31st. The credit services provider reported $4.15 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$4.05 by $0.10. The business had revenue of $8.13 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$7.95 billion. Mastercard had a net margin of 44.93% and a return on equity of 200.01%. The company's revenue for the quarter was up 16.8%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$3.50 EPS. On average, analysts anticipate that Mastercard Incorporated will post 15.91 EPS for the current year.

About Mastercard

Mastercard Incorporated, a technology company, provides transaction processing and other payment-related products and services in the United States and internationally. The company offers integrated products and value-added services for account holders, merchants, financial institutions, digital partners, businesses, governments, and other organizations, such as programs that enable issuers to provide consumers with credits to defer payments; payment products and solutions that allow its customers to access funds in deposit and other accounts; prepaid programs services; and commercial credit, debit, and prepaid payment products and solutions.
